Kegeldeckeliges Jochzahnmoos vs Gewöhnliches Jochzahnmoos
Zygodon conoideus compared with Zygodon rupestris
Key Differences
- Kegeldeckeliges Jochzahnmoos is Least Concern while Gewöhnliches Jochzahnmoos is Vulnerable.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Kegeldeckeliges Jochzahnmoos | Gewöhnliches Jochzahnmoos |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Pflanzen) | Plantae (Pflanzen) |
| Phylum same | Bryophyta | Bryophyta |
| Class same |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) |
| Order same | Orthotrichales (Orthotrichales) | Orthotrichales (Orthotrichales) |
| Family same | Orthotrichaceae | Orthotrichaceae |
| Genus same | Zygodon | Zygodon |
| Species | Zygodon conoideus | Zygodon rupestris |
Evolutionary Relationship
Kegeldeckeliges Jochzahnmoos and Gewöhnliches Jochzahnmoos share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Zygodon.

Habitat & Geographic Range
Kegeldeckeliges Jochzahnmoos
Native to Europe and North America, inhabiting ecosystems characteristic of the region.
Found across Europe (6 countries) and North America (United States).
Gewöhnliches Jochzahnmoos
Native to Europe, inhabiting ecosystems characteristic of the region.
Found across Europe (6 countries). Curr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
